Dried Ephedra Sinica Stems from Japan
Dried stems of the Ephedra sinica plant, commonly known as Ma Huang, used primarily in traditional Chinese medicine for its ephedrine content. Classified under HTS 1211.50.00.00 as ephedra, a plant part used for pharmaceutical purposes, whether dried or powdered.

Import Tips
• Verify ephedrine alkaloid content complies with FDA import alerts; provide lab analysis certificates
• Include botanical identification and country-of-origin documentation to confirm it's Ephedra species
• Avoid misclassification as finished medicaments; this covers raw plant material only
